This is a list of members of Parliament (MPs) elected in the 1885 general election, held over several days from 24 November 1885 to 18 December 1885.

| Party | Seats |
|---|---|
| Liberal Party | 319 |
| Conservative Party | 247 |
| Irish Parliamentary Party | 86 |
| Independent Liberal | 11 |
| Crofters Party | 4 |
| Independent Conservative | 1 |
| Independent Lib-Lab | 1 |
